- The distance between Lashio, Myanmar and Poznan, Poland is approximately 7,403 km or 4,601 mi.
- To reach Lashio in this distance one would set out from Poznan bearing 82.3°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Lashio bearing 139° or SE .
- Lashio has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Poznan has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Lashio is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Poznan is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 13.6 °C (24.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 9.1 °C (16.4°F) less in Lashio.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 866 mm (34.1 in) more which is equivalent to 866 l/m² (21.25 US gal/ft²) or 8,660,000 l/ha (925,811 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 29.3° higher in Lashio than in Poznan.
